Navigate360 is the leader in training, tools, and technology for schools to promote, maintain, and improve the health and educational well-being of students in over 13K K-12 institutions in the United States. In response to incidents of violence, reduced mental health and the rise of social media, many states and school districts have mandated that schools implement technology to detect and intervene with threats of violence before they are realized.
Our Machine Learning and Data Science team is hiring a part-time data science to work during the school year, part time up to 20 hours per week.
- Open to undergraduate or graduate students.
- 1 Semester – renewable for up to 3 in a school year depending on performance and quality of deliverables.
- 3 Month Summer Internships (full-time)
- Part-Time (school year) Internships: 10-30 hours / week (flexible hours based on your schedule targeting an average of 20 hours per week)
Internships will be set up to provide 2 deliverables during the semester-long program:
- Working prototype with code review and written/verbal presentation and demonstration – focused on an actual product problem, feature, or functionality that is intended to go ‘in-product’ within the subsequent 6-12 months. Partnered with an FTE as their immediate supervisor / mentor on a day-to-day basis.
- Written research paper on an emerging product or market area of interest relevant to the same product space as the working prototype or as foundational thinking for the prototype itself. This should include full references to peer-reviewed or established literature with a review of the ‘current state’ in the field, hypothesis(es) to be evaluated and conclusions / recommendations for Navigate360 or a customer segment. This paper can be provided to the school to receive credit (depending on the institution’s internship policy/program).
In addition, you will work day-to-day with an experienced data scientist or analyst to work on specific projects to help us understand the impact of interventions on students, measure performance for a new software product and features, and help develop insights that will be used by customers to help keep students and communities safe.
Relevant Undergraduate Majors: Computer Science (w/ emphasis on Data Science), Data Science, Statistics, Mathematics, Economics (quantitative concentration) or other quantitative discipline in hard sciences (Physics, etc.).
Example Projects:
- Perform an analysis on prepared dataset with data visualizations, build predictive models that provide recommendations to customers or management.
- Build an interactive analytical tool (PowerBI, Shiny, etc.) that enables analysts to drill down into a complex dataset, draw conclusions, and work with a data engineer to automate updates to the data.
- Exploratory data analysis on a new, raw dataset, documenting properties of the data, assessing data quality, and formulating and testing hypotheses, producing a prototype data pipeline design with cleansed data prepared for analysis or machine learning. Present the findings and recommendations to engineering and product teams.
